맞춤기술찾기

이전대상기술

얼굴 애니메이션 리타게팅 방법 및 이를 위한 기록 매체

  • 기술번호 : KST2015115268
  • 담당센터 : 대전기술혁신센터
  • 전화번호 : 042-610-2279
요약, Int. CL, CPC, 출원번호/일자, 출원인, 등록번호/일자, 공개번호/일자, 공고번호/일자, 국제출원번호/일자, 국제공개번호/일자, 우선권정보, 법적상태, 심사진행상태, 심판사항, 구분, 원출원번호/일자, 관련 출원번호, 기술이전 희망, 심사청구여부/일자, 심사청구항수의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 서지정보 표입니다.
요약 얼굴 애니메이션 리타게팅 방법 및 이를 위한 기록 매체를 공개한다. 본 발명은 하나의 타겟 모델에 대해 RBF 기반 회기 트레이닝 및 kCCA 기반 회기 트레이닝을 각각 1회씩 수행하고, 이후 RBF 기반 회기 트레이닝 결과 및 kCCA 기반 회기 트레이닝 결과를 조합함에 의해 형태학적으로 매우 상이한 타겟 모델에 대해서도 소스 애니메이션의 표정에 대응하는 매우 자연스러운 표정을 회득 할 수 있다. 또한 모션 와핑을 추가함에 의해 타겟 모델의 개성을 더욱 두드러지게 표현할 수 있다.
Int. CL G06T 13/00 (2011.01)
CPC G06T 13/40(2013.01) G06T 13/40(2013.01) G06T 13/40(2013.01) G06T 13/40(2013.01)
출원번호/일자 1020110056907 (2011.06.13)
출원인 한국과학기술원
등록번호/일자 10-1261737-0000 (2013.04.30)
공개번호/일자 10-2012-0137826 (2012.12.24) 문서열기
공고번호/일자 (20130509) 문서열기
국제출원번호/일자
국제공개번호/일자
우선권정보
법적상태 소멸
심사진행상태 수리
심판사항
구분 신규
원출원번호/일자
관련 출원번호
심사청구여부/일자 Y (2011.06.13)
심사청구항수 21

출원인

번호, 이름, 국적, 주소의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 인명정보 - 출원인 표입니다.
번호 이름 국적 주소
1 한국과학기술원 대한민국 대전광역시 유성구

발명자

번호, 이름, 국적, 주소의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 인명정보 - 발명자 표입니다.
번호 이름 국적 주소
1 노준용 대한민국 대전광역시 유성구
2 송재원 대한민국 대전광역시 유성구
3 최병국 대한민국 대전광역시 유성구
4 설영호 대한민국 대전광역시 유성구

대리인

번호, 이름, 국적, 주소의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 인명정보 - 대리인 표입니다.
번호 이름 국적 주소
1 특허법인 다해 대한민국 서울특별시 강남구 삼성로***, *층(삼성동,고운빌딩)

최종권리자

번호, 이름, 국적, 주소의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 인명정보 - 최종권리자 표입니다.
번호 이름 국적 주소
1 한국과학기술원 대전광역시 유성구
번호, 서류명, 접수/발송일자, 처리상태, 접수/발송일자의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 행정처리 표입니다.
번호 서류명 접수/발송일자 처리상태 접수/발송번호
1 [특허출원]특허출원서
[Patent Application] Patent Application
2011.06.13 수리 (Accepted) 1-1-2011-0443075-09
2 선행기술조사의뢰서
Request for Prior Art Search
2012.04.12 수리 (Accepted) 9-1-9999-9999999-89
3 선행기술조사보고서
Report of Prior Art Search
2012.05.25 수리 (Accepted) 9-1-2012-0041852-38
4 의견제출통지서
Notification of reason for refusal
2012.06.19 발송처리완료 (Completion of Transmission) 9-5-2012-0355612-12
5 [명세서등 보정]보정서
[Amendment to Description, etc.] Amendment
2012.08.20 보정승인간주 (Regarded as an acceptance of amendment) 1-1-2012-0663409-94
6 [거절이유 등 통지에 따른 의견]의견(답변, 소명)서
[Opinion according to the Notification of Reasons for Refusal] Written Opinion(Written Reply, Written Substantiation)
2012.08.20 수리 (Accepted) 1-1-2012-0663408-48
7 거절결정서
Decision to Refuse a Patent
2012.12.10 발송처리완료 (Completion of Transmission) 9-5-2012-0749540-08
8 [명세서등 보정]보정서(재심사)
Amendment to Description, etc(Reexamination)
2013.01.04 보정승인 (Acceptance of amendment) 1-1-2013-0011389-33
9 [거절이유 등 통지에 따른 의견]의견(답변, 소명)서
[Opinion according to the Notification of Reasons for Refusal] Written Opinion(Written Reply, Written Substantiation)
2013.01.04 수리 (Accepted) 1-1-2013-0011388-98
10 최후의견제출통지서
Notification of reason for final refusal
2013.01.21 발송처리완료 (Completion of Transmission) 9-5-2013-0041575-13
11 [명세서등 보정]보정서
[Amendment to Description, etc.] Amendment
2013.01.22 보정승인 (Acceptance of amendment) 1-1-2013-0063146-19
12 [거절이유 등 통지에 따른 의견]의견(답변, 소명)서
[Opinion according to the Notification of Reasons for Refusal] Written Opinion(Written Reply, Written Substantiation)
2013.01.22 수리 (Accepted) 1-1-2013-0063145-63
13 출원인정보변경(경정)신고서
Notification of change of applicant's information
2013.02.01 수리 (Accepted) 4-1-2013-5019983-17
14 등록결정서
Decision to Grant Registration
2013.04.29 발송처리완료 (Completion of Transmission) 9-5-2013-0288782-38
15 [출원서등 보정]보정서
[Amendment to Patent Application, etc.] Amendment
2014.03.04 수리 (Accepted) 1-1-2014-0212868-40
16 출원인정보변경(경정)신고서
Notification of change of applicant's information
2014.12.24 수리 (Accepted) 4-1-2014-5157968-69
17 출원인정보변경(경정)신고서
Notification of change of applicant's information
2014.12.24 수리 (Accepted) 4-1-2014-5158129-58
18 출원인정보변경(경정)신고서
Notification of change of applicant's information
2014.12.24 수리 (Accepted) 4-1-2014-5157993-01
19 출원인정보변경(경정)신고서
Notification of change of applicant's information
2019.04.24 수리 (Accepted) 4-1-2019-5081392-49
20 출원인정보변경(경정)신고서
Notification of change of applicant's information
2020.05.15 수리 (Accepted) 4-1-2020-5108396-12
21 출원인정보변경(경정)신고서
Notification of change of applicant's information
2020.06.12 수리 (Accepted) 4-1-2020-5131486-63
번호, 청구항의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 청구항 표입니다.
번호 청구항
1 1
입력 데이터인 소스 애니메이션이 입력되는 단계;소스 애니메이션과 타겟 애니메이션 사이에 표정 쌍 범위가 설정되는 단계;상기 설정된 표정 쌍 범위에 대해 RBF(Radial Basis Function) 기반 회귀 트레이닝이 수행되는 단계;상기 설정된 표정 쌍 범위에 대해 kCCA(Kernel Canonical Correlation Analysis) 기반 회귀 트레이닝이 수행되는 단계; 및상기 RBF 기반 회귀 트레이닝 결과 및 kCCA 기반 회귀 트레이닝 결과가 사용자에 의해 지정된 블렌딩 파라미터에 의해 조합되어 상기 소스 애니메이션의 표정에 대응하는 상기 타겟 애니메이션의 표정을 생성하는 최종 리타게팅 단계를 구비하는 얼굴 애니메이션 리타게팅 방법
2 2
제1 항에 있어서, 상기 소스 애니메이션이 입력되는 단계는미리 캡쳐되어 리타게팅된 인체 모델의 블렌드쉐이프(blendshapes)가 상기 입력 데이터로서 인가되는 것을 특징으로 하는 얼굴 애니메이션 리타게팅 방법
3 3
제2 항에 있어서, 상기 표정 쌍 범위가 설정되는 단계는외부로부터 소스 애니메이션과 타겟 애니메이션에서 의미적으로 동일한 얼굴 표정을 갖는 구간을 지정하는 명령이 입력되면, 상기 동일한 얼굴 표정을 갖는 구간이 상기 표정 쌍 범위로 설정되는 단계; 및상기 표정 쌍 범위가 행렬식으로 변환되는 단계를 구비하는 것을 특징으로 하는 얼굴 애니메이션 리타게팅 방법
4 4
제3 항에 있어서, 상기 표정 쌍 범위로 설정되는 단계는상기 소스 애니메이션과 상기 타겟 애니메이션 각각에서 수학식(여기서 bi는 대응하는 가중치 wi의 블렌드쉐이프이며, Sourceexp와 targetexp는 각각 소스 애니메이션과 타겟 애니메이션에서 의미적으로 동일한 얼굴 표정을 나타낸다
5 5
제4 항에 있어서, 상기 행렬식으로 변환되는 단계는상기 소스 애니메이션과 상기 타겟 애니메이션 각각을 수학식 및(여기서 S는 소스 애니메이션의 표정 행렬의 범위를 나타내고, T는 소스 애니메이션의 표정 행렬의 범위(S)에 대응하는 타겟 애니메이션의 표정 행렬의 범위를 나타낸다
6 6
제5 항에 있어서, 상기 RBF 기반 회귀 트레이닝이 수행되는 단계는RBF 가중치가 계산되는 단계; 및상기 RBF 가중치를 이용하여 RBF 출력 벡터가 계산되는 단계를 구비하는 것을 특징으로 하는 얼굴 애니메이션 리타게팅 방법
7 7
제6 항에 있어서, 상기 RBF 가중치가 계산되는 단계는상기 RBF 가중치가 수학식 (여기서 ri는 계산되어야 하는 상기 RBF 가중치를 나타내고, np는 표정 쌍 범위의 개수를 나타내고, wi는 가중치 입력 벡터를 나타내며, F(wi)는 계산된 출력을 나타낸다
8 8
제7 항에 있어서, 상기 RBF 출력 벡터가 계산되는 단계는상기 가중치 입력 벡터(wi(i= 1, 2,
9 9
제8 항에 있어서, 상기 kCCA 기반 회귀 트레이닝 단계는상기 소스 애니메이션의 표정 행렬(S)과 상기 타겟 애니메이션의 표정 행렬(T)을 이용하여 상관 계수(correlation coefficient)(ρ)가 계산되는 단계;표준 선형 회귀를 이용하여 최소 자승 판별값이 최소화되도록 리타게팅 모델이 생성되는 단계;생성된 리타게팅 모델로부터 kCCA 선형 연산자(MkCCA)가 계산되는 단계; 및상기 kCCA 선형 연산자(MkCCA)와 커널 함수를 이용하여 획득되는 커널화된 벡터()를 이용하여 kCCA 출력 벡터가 계산되는 단계를 구비하고,상기 상관 계수가 수학식(여기서, hs, ht 는 계수 벡터(coefficient vector)로서 각각 와, 로 계산되며, φ함수는 특정 데이터를 낮은 차원으로 매핑시키는 함수이며, 데이터의 차원을 낮추는 데 사용된다
10 10
삭제
11 11
제9 항에 있어서, 상기 최종 리타게팅 단계는최종 리타게팅 출력 벡터(tfinal)가 상기 RBF 기반 회귀 트레이닝 결과인 RBF 출력 벡터(tRBF)와 상기 kCCA 기반 회귀 트레이닝 결과인 kCCA 출력 벡터(tkCCA)를 애니메이터에 의해 설정되는 상기 블렌딩 파라미터(α)에 의해 수학식(여기서, 블렌딩 파라미터(blending parameter)(α)는 [0, 1] 범위 내의 실수)로서 계산되는 것을 특징으로 하는 얼굴 애니메이션 리타게팅 방법
12 12
제11 항에 있어서, 상기 얼굴 애니메이션 리타게팅 방법은상기 타겟 애니메이션에 대해 모션 와핑이 수행되는 단계를 더 구비하는 것을 특징으로 하는 얼굴 애니메이션 리타게팅 방법
13 13
제12 항에 있어서, 상기 모션 와핑이 수행되는 단계는상기 소스 애니메이션의 특정 감성적 시퀀스를 위해 상기 타겟 애니메이션의 얼굴 형태와 표정 변화의 타이밍 양쪽이 모두 포함되는 감성적 시퀀스 쌍이 외부로부터 인가되는 명령에 응답하여 설정되는 단계;상기 감성적 시퀀스 쌍에서 모션 와핑이 수행되어야할 구간이 획득되도록 휴리스틱 탐색이 수행되는 단계; 및상기 휴리스틱 탐색을 통해 획득된 구간에 대해 1차원 라플라시안 좌표(1D Laplacian coordinates)를 이용하여 상기 타겟 애니메이션의 움직임 구간들에 대응하는 원본 리타게트된 움직임 곡선에 대해 모션 와핑이 수행되는 단계를 구비하는 것을 특징으로 하는 얼굴 애니메이션 리타게팅 방법
14 14
제13 항에 있어서, 상기 휴리스틱 탐색이 수행되는 단계는상기 모션 와핑이 수행되어야 할 시작 프레임들(Fst)이 수학식(여기서 은 리타게트된 소스 움직임의 현재 시작 프레임이고, 는 소스 쌍 구간의 시작 프레임이고, δ는 애니메이터 또는 사용자에 의해 지정되는 문턱값이다
15 15
제14 항에 있어서, 상기 1차원 라플라시안 좌표를 이용하여 모션 와핑이 수행되는 단계는상기 1차원 라플라시안 좌표상의 모든 타겟 제어 차원(nt)에 대해 전체 n개의 프레임들에서 키 값(key value)(f(t))이 변환되는 단계;라플라시안 좌표(L)가 수학식(여기서, Fo는 매 제어 차원에 대한 모든 키 값을 저장하는 n X nt 행렬이고, Δ는 (n-1)X n 인 1차원 라플라시안 행렬)Δ의 원소는 수학식에 의해 계산되는 단계를 구비하는 것을 특징으로 하는 얼굴 애니메이션 리타게팅 방법
16 16
제15 항에 있어서, 상기 1차원 라플라시안 좌표를 이용하여 모션 와핑이 수행되는 단계는 상기 1차원 라플라시안 좌표로부터 최종 키 값(F)들이 복원되는 단계; 및수학식 (여기서, T는 m X nt 행렬을 의미하고, CT는 T에 대응하는 열에 1을 갖는 m X n 행렬을 의미한다
17 17
제1 항 내지 제9 항 및 제11 항 내지 제16 항 중 어느 한 항에 있어서, 상기 얼굴 애니메이션 리타게팅 방법을 실행하기 위한 프로그램 명령어가 기록된, 컴퓨터가 판독가능한 기록매체
18 18
소스 애니메이션의 특정 감성적 시퀀스를 위해 타겟 애니메이션의 얼굴 형태와 표정 변화의 타이밍 양쪽이 모두 포함되는 감성적 시퀀스 쌍이 외부로부터 인가되는 명령에 응답하여 설정되는 단계;상기 감성적 시퀀스 쌍에서 모션 와핑이 수행되어야할 구간이 획득되도록 휴리스틱 탐색이 수행되는 단계; 및상기 휴리스틱 탐색을 통해 획득된 구간에 대해 1차원 라플라시안 좌표(1D Laplacian coordinates)를 이용하여 상기 타겟 애니메이션의 움직임 구간들에 대응하는 원본 리타게트된 움직임 곡선에 대해 모션 와핑이 수행되는 단계를 구비하는 것을 특징으로 하는 얼굴 애니메이션 모션 와핑 방법
19 19
제18 항에 있어서, 상기 휴리스틱 탐색이 수행되는 단계는상기 모션 와핑이 수행되어야 할 시작 프레임들(Fst)이 수학식(여기서 은 리타게트된 소스 움직임의 현재 시작 프레임이고, 는 소스 쌍 구간의 시작 프레임이고, δ는 애니메이터 또는 사용자에 의해 지정되는 문턱값이다
20 20
제19 항에 있어서, 상기 1차원 라플라시안 좌표를 이용하여 모션 와핑이 수행되는 단계는상기 1차원 라플라시안 좌표상의 모든 타겟 제어 차원(nt)에 대해 전체 n개의 프레임들 각각에서 키 값(key value)(f(t))이 변환되는 단계;라플라시안 좌표(L)가 수학식(여기서, Fo는 매 제어 차원에 대한 모든 키 값들을 저장하는 n X nt 행렬이고, Δ는 (n-1)X n 인 1차원 라플라시안 행렬)Δ의 원소는 수학식에 의해 계산되는 단계를 구비하는 것을 특징으로 하는 얼굴 애니메이션 모션 와핑 방법
21 21
제20 항에 있어서, 상기 1차원 라플라시안 좌표를 이용하여 모션 와핑이 수행되는 단계는 상기 1차원 라플라시안 좌표로부터 최종 키 값(F)들이 복원되는 단계; 및수학식 (여기서, T는 m X nt 행렬을 의미하고, CT는 T에 대응하는 열에 1을 갖는 m X n 행렬을 의미한다
22 22
제18 항 내지 제21 항 중 어느 한 항에 있어서, 상기 얼굴 애니메이션 모션 와핑 방법을 실행하기 위한 프로그램 명령어가 기록된, 컴퓨터가 판독가능한 기록매체
지정국 정보가 없습니다
패밀리정보가 없습니다
순번, 연구부처, 주관기관, 연구사업, 연구과제의 정보를 제공하는 이전대상기술 뷰 페이지 상세정보 > 국가R&D 연구정보 정보 표입니다.
순번 연구부처 주관기관 연구사업 연구과제
1 문화체육관광부 한국과학기술원 콘텐츠산업기술지원사업(지정공모) 2D 동영상의 고품질 3D 입체 동영상 변환 자동화 기술
2 미래창조과학부 ㈜디지털아이디어 첨단융복합콘텐츠기술개발지원사업 고품질 3D 영상의 효율적인 제작을 위한 파이프라인 관리 및 온스테이지 사전시각화 기술 개발